Exclusive: Peacock has opted not to proceed with a second season of Brave New World. Ucp, the studio behind the sci-fi drama series, based on Aldous Huxley’s groundbreaking novel, will shop it to other outlets.
“There will not be Season 2 of Brave New World on Peacock,” the streamer said in a statement to Deadline. “David Wiener created a thought-provoking and cinematic adaptation. We’re grateful to the cast and crew who brought this world to life. We look forward to telling more stories with David in the future.
This marks the first major TV series cancellation since Susan Rovner joined NBCUniversal earlier this month as Chairman, Entertainment Content, overseeing programming for television and streaming.
Brave New World was part of Peacock’s inaugural original slate and the only homegrown scripted series available at launch in July. The big-budget drama did not generate a lot of buzz among critics and fans.
